Program Overview
- Program Delivery: Offered 100% online through accelerated, 6-week courses.
- Coursework: 30 credit hours: Complete in less than 1 year or work at your own pace.
- Flexible Start Dates: Applications are accepted for the Spring, Summer, and Fall semesters.
- High-Impact Experiences: Students gain hands-on experience working with data, analytics, and emerging technologies driving modern AI-powered tools.
- AACSB Accreditation: It's the gold standard for business programs, the hallmark of excellence in business education, and has been earned by less than five percent of the world's business programs.
- Simple Admission Process: We do not require GRE/GMAT tests for admission.
- Who Should Apply: The M.S. Information Technology complements any undergraduate major, whether you studied management, history, technology, or any other field and will prepare you for to be a leader and innovator in high-demand career fields.

Industry Recognized Credentials
Certificates
Students will earn their SAS and Maven Analytics in Python Programming certificates while enrolled in the M.S. Information Technology program. These certificates are respected globally across various industries. Having these certificates can significantly bolster students resumes and make them an attractive candidate to employers in fields like data analytics, business intelligence, and more.
- SAS Certificate: This certificate focuses on leveraging SAS software for statistical analysis and data management. Mastering SAS can be particularly advantageous if you're looking to work in industries that rely heavily on data analytics, healthcare, or financial services, where SAS is a standard tool.
- Maven Analytics in Python Programming Certificate: The Maven Analytics in Python Programming certificate takes a deep dive into Python Programming, which is essential for a broader range of applications, including data science, machine learning, web development, and more. Python's versatility and its growing adoption in the tech industry make this certification immensely useful if you're aiming for roles that involve programming and data manipulation.
- Additionally, through electives, students can complete additional certificates like Power BI and Predictive Analytics in SAS.
